North Dumfries, ON Real Estate - Houses For Sale in North Dumfries, Ontario

The housing stock of North Dumfries is composed predominantly of single detached homes and townhouses. This part of the Kitchener - Cambridge - Waterloo metropolitan area offers mainly three bedroom and four or more bedroom homes. Around 90% of the dwellings in the township are occupied by homeowners and the rest are rented. This township did not experience a single construction boom; the construction of new homes in North Dumfries was spread throughout several decades in the twentieth and twenty-first century.  Read more about North Dumfries real estate

About Living in North Dumfries, Ontario

Transportation

The best way to move around in North Dumfries is very often driving. Finding a parking spot is generally easy. Many of the houses for sale in this part of the Kitchener - Cambridge - Waterloo metropolitan area are located in places that are not very well-suited for those who travel by foot because almost no common errands can be run without the use of a car. This township is also not very bike-friendly since the cycling infrastructure is quite bad, and there is a considerable amount of hills.

Services

There are only a very small number of primary schools in North Dumfries and therefore they can be a very long walk away. Likewise, this part of the Kitchener - Cambridge - Waterloo metropolitan area does not contain any high schools. Furthermore, parents and their schoolchildren may find it very difficult to reach daycares on foot. In terms of eating, in all cases, a car is needed to shop for groceries.

Character

North Dumfries is reasonably good for those who prefer quiet surroundings, as there are generally low levels of noise from traffic - however some parts can be quite loud, especially closer to Highway 401 or the railway line. Getting to green spaces, including Piper's Glen Park and Schmidt Park, is rather challenging from a large number of locations in the township since they are spread out sporadically. Despite that, there are around 10 parks nearby for residents to check out.
